A ball is moving in a perfect circle at constant speed.
Is the ball accelerating?
Yes, the velocity changes direction constantly.
A book sits on a table. Does it have gravitational potential energy?
Relative to what?
If 0 at table, then no Ug.
If 0 at ground, then yes Ug.

Two balls are dropped at same height, Ball A with mass 2 kg, Ball B with mass 4 kg. Ignoring air resistance: Which hits the ground with greater speed?
Same speed.
mgh = (1/2)mv^2
v = sqrt(2gh)
